Finance Manager Role Summary
">This position involves leading the financial performance of the organization, working closely with entity finance managers to ensure accuracy and timeliness in month-end closing. The successful candidate will provide financial expertise and insights to enhance financial performance.
">Main Responsibilities:
">- Partner with entity finance managers to support consistency and accuracy in financial reporting.">
- Assist the head of financial reporting with group accounting and intercompany transactions.">
- Provide financial analysis and recommendations to improve financial performance.">
- Liaise between Group Finance reporting and commercial finance teams.">
- Lead the preparation of month-end accounts and provide informative commentary.">
- Liaise with external auditors for regulatory compliance.">
- Involved in budgeting, forecasting, cashflow management, and treasury operations.">
- Identify and implement process improvements across finance teams, driving efficiency and cost savings.">
- Lead, mentor, and guide finance team members.">
- ">
Required Skills and Qualifications:
">- ACA/ACCA/CIMA/CPA qualified accountant with 5+ years PQE.">
- Excellent organizational and time management skills.">
- Demonstrated strategic financial acumen and analytical mindset.">
- Ability to work on a tactical and strategic level.">
- Commercial awareness with ability to provide financial insights.">
